WWE ID recruit to be revealed at Reality of Wrestling event

WWE will announce one member of its new Independent Development (WWE ID) program this weekend.
The news will be revealed at Reality of Wrestling’s Super Sunday event on November 10 at the Walker Texas Lawyer Arena in Texas City, Texas.
“Someone’s been ID’d… be there this Sunday to find out who,” the WWE ID X account wrote.

Booker T’s Reality of Wrestling is one of five schools to receive WWE ID designation. The others are Cody Rhodes’ Nightmare Factory in Atlanta, Seth Rollins’ Black and Brave Academy in Davenport, Elite Pro Wrestling Training Center in Concord, N.H., and KnokX Pro Academy in Los Angeles.
It’s unclear if the WWE ID recruit to be named is already advertised for Sunday’s show, but those who are include Richard Holliday, Alex Gracia, Ice Williams, and Cam Cole. Joe Hendry has also been announced for the event.
